Bunk Beds for Teens: Maximizing Space and Style

Bunk beds have long been a popular choice for children, however their energy and beauty extend far beyond the early years. With rising housing costs and the ever-increasing requirement for efficient space utilization in homes, bunk beds are ending up being an appealing alternative for teenagers also. Benefits of Bunk Beds for Teens

1. Maximizing Space

As teenagers grow, so do their valuables. Bunk beds offer a distinct option for space restrictions, enabling two beds to occupy the footprint of one. This is specifically useful in smaller sized bed rooms or shared areas, where flooring space is restricted.

2. Encouraging Independence

Bunk beds can serve as a rite of passage for teens. Transitioning to a bunk bed typically signifies their move towards independence, offering them with a personal space that reflects their style and choices.

3. Flexible Designs

Modern bunk beds can be found in various designs and setups, making them appropriate for diverse aesthetics-- from smooth and minimalist to rustic and industrial. This adaptability makes it easy to integrate a bunk bed into any space design.

4. Multi-functional Use

Lots of bunk beds come equipped with built-in functions such as desks, shelves, or even couches, making them multi-functional. This can assist teens arrange their research study materials and personal items without jeopardizing on space.

5. Cost-Effective

Investing in a bunk bed can frequently be more economical than acquiring two different beds. Furthermore, they can last for several years, providing great value gradually.

Things to Consider When Choosing a Bunk Bed

When searching for a bunk bed for teens, there are several elements to think about. Here's an extensive list to direct you:

1. Security Features

  • Guardrails: Ensure that the top bunk has tough guardrails on both sides to prevent falls.
  • Ladder Design: A safe and easy-to-climb ladder is necessary for safety; think about the angle and placement.

2. Material

  • Wood vs. Metal: Wooden bunk beds typically offer a more traditional and warm look, while metal choices can use a modern feel. Choose a material that matches the room's total decoration.

3. Size

  • Requirement Twin vs. Full Size: Decide between twin or full-size mattresses. Full-size bunks supply beauty sleep space, which can be advantageous for growing teens.

4. Assembly and Stability

  • Ease of Assembly: Consider how simple it is to assemble the bunk bed and whether you'll require professional aid.
  • Sturdiness: Check for stability in the design; the bed should not wobble when utilized.

5. Style and Personalization

  • Color and Finish: Choose a color and surface that matches the room's decoration. Consider enabling your teenager to individualize their space with bed linen and decoration.

6. Budget plan

  • Cost Range: Establish a spending plan ahead of time and search for choices within that range. Bear in mind that certain features might affect rates.

FAQs About Bunk Beds for Teens

1. Are bunk beds safe for teenagers?

Yes, as long as they are designed with security functions such as guardrails and durable ladders. It's essential to follow the maker's suggestions for weight limitations and use.

2. Can bunk beds suit any bedroom?

A lot of bunk beds can be found in various designs and sizes, making them versatile to various room configurations. Nevertheless, make sure to measure the space's dimensions and think about ceiling height for security.

3. How do I preserve a bunk bed?

Routinely inspect the stability of the bed by tightening screws, bolts, and any moving parts. Clean and dust the bed routinely, and check for any indications of wear or damage.

4. Can I personalize the bunk bed for my teen?

Absolutely! Numerous bunk beds can be customized with various bed linen, wall colors, and decoration items to show your teenager's personal design.

5. What is the life-span of a bunk bed?

With proper care, a well-made bunk bed can last for a number of years, often outliving the teenage years and ending up being a financial investment for future usages.
